The Commonwealth of Massachusetts

Client

EOTSS places our customers and constituents at the heart of everything we do. We offer responsive digital services and productivity tools to more than 40,000 state employees, who provide essential information and services to the citizens of the Commonwealth.


We also serve constituents, providing them with digital services and tools that enable taxpayers, motorists, businesses, visitors, families, and other citizens to do business with the Commonwealth in a way that makes every interaction with government easier, faster, and more secure.

Project

My role on this project was to act as the subject matter expert and manage the life cycle for all of the government owned hardware and software assets. I worked with outside auditors (KPMG) & internal teams on the data migration from IBM system to ServiceNow. I also worked along side ServiceNow developers to gather requirements from stakeholders necessary to design forms, views, portal pages.


Additionally, create user-friendly documentation on ServiceNow tips & tricks to facilitate the transition between applications for seasoned ITIL & everyday users.

Challenges

  • Data discrepancies.
  • Inability to integrate old IBM system with ServiceNow.
  • Extensive amount of data to be reconciled manually.
  • Missing financial & contractual asset data.

Tools & Technology

  • IBM Maximo
  • ServiceNow
  • IBM Tivoli
  • Microsoft Office Suite (Excell / Word  / PowerPoint), Photoshop, Illustrator
  • HTML / JavaScript / CSS / SQL

Solution

  1. EOTSS completed a comprehensive inventory of capital fixed assets including software, hardware, and non-IT holdings. This several-month undertaking, which involved contributions from Finance, Operations, Facilities, and Procurement, represents the first comprehensive capital fixed asset inventory completed by MassIT/EOTSS staff in recent memory.
  2. We deployed several changes for our Incident management, Asset management, Change management, Problem management, Service catalog, Service portal & Procurement applications to meet the need of the organisation and external clients. We then migrated the result from our reconciliation and mapped all records to ServiceNow configurations.

Process & Final Product

Gathering requirements

Meet with asset owners and stakeholders to determine possible builds for each role within ServiceNow. Such as forms, configuration Items, reports, dashboards & portal views.

Data migration

Reconcile and migrate asset records between 3 sources (ServiceNow Discover, KPM Audit & Finance report), using key data point such as Model, Cost, Version, Components, Status, Cost, Depreciation, Contracts, etc.. to analyze determine valuable data.

User-friendly documentation

Use a Simplified Technical English (STE) and minimalist approach to writing "How To's" knowledge articles for less experienced users.
